Understanding Sankey Charts: A Fundament – An Overview

At their core, Sankey charts visualize the flow of quantities in complex systems. Unlike traditional bar or pie charts, which present data statically, Sankey diagrams illustrate the trajectory of data flows, drawing the viewer’s eye in a sequential manner. The size of each element within the chart represents the volume of the corresponding factor, offering a tangible insight into the dynamics of interconnected data streams.

Applications: A Peek into the Versatile World of Sankey Charts

The applications of Sankey charts extend far and wide, encompassing various realms where understanding flow dynamics is crucial. Here are a few applications to consider:

  • Business Analysis: To illustrate the flow of revenue in various departments or the distribution of costs between different production stages.
  • Environmental Data: To show the pathway of pollutants through ecosystems or the trajectory of greenhouse gases in the atmosphere.
  • Energy Research: To present the efficiency of energy production, distribution, and usage in different systems.
  • Process Design: For visualizing resource usage and waste generation in industrial processes, aiding in the identification of potential improvement and reduction opportunities.
